En Formula 1 as in its electric inclination, the Formula E, the Monaco meeting constitutes the jewel in the crown. The Monaco e-Prix, contested this Saturday April 30, honored a driver whose emblem on the nose of the car is a star: Stoffel Vandoorne (Mercedes). Starting fourth, the Belgian played perfectly with the circumstances to triumph in the streets of Monte-Carlo, ahead of Mitch Evans (Jaguar) and Jean-Éric Vergne (DS Techeetah) to steal control of the championship from the Frenchman.
